5. Train To Busan

Commuting can be a pain as it is, but when a vital outbreak occurs in Korea, the Train to Busan turns into a one-way ticket to hell. This relentless zombie thriller takes the best bits from World War Z, being the fast unstoppable zombies that dogpile one and other and combined it with the cramped and claustrophobic atmosphere of Snow Piecer.

Yeon Sang-ho doesn’t waste a moment of the audiences time here and uses every single part of the train to great effect. Carriage by carriage our survivors have to deal with the dead in new and interesting ways. Even when Gong Yoo and the rest aren't running for their lives, the tension could be cut with a knife.

Fast zombies are so easily done wrong, but this sits up there with 28 Days Later and Dawn of the Dead as one of the greats. But unlike both of them has a strong emotional element, that doesn’t just feel tacked on.

The opening scene alone is enough to get Train to Busan on this list and might have the strongest in a zombie film yet - bar 28 Weeks Later, but this Korean zombie flick never lets up and is one of the most stressful experiences ever put to film.
